Transaction 674484c191854a2a21e215322b38c0a98980c6033dbe0556c14a1853f237b60c
1 Input
1 Output
-
674484c191854a2a21e215322b38c0a98980c6033dbe0556c14a1853f237b60c:0
- value
- 9609319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37951db8cfc25fdc2bffe521492ca0eb965457e4 OP_EQUAL
- address
- MCy42kQbzr86AdXw5MMz4fGrELvrcFrFZY